vsketch项目安装与配置指南
1. 项目基础介绍
vsketch是一个基于Python的生成艺术工具包,专为绘图机设计。它致力于提供易用性、自动化、绘图机特有的功能以及与其他流行包的互操作性。vsketch包含一个命令行工具vsk,用于自动化草图的整个项目生命周期,以及一个类似于Processing的API,方便用户实现自己的草图。
主要编程语言:Python
2. 项目使用的关键技术和框架
- 命令行工具(CLI):自动化草图项目的创建、迭代和导出。
- Processing-like API:提供简便的方法来实现生成艺术草图。
- vpype:一个用于处理SVG文件的库,与vsketch紧密集成。
- Numpy和Shapely:用于绘图机生成艺术的强大库。
3. 项目安装和配置的准备工作
在开始安装之前,请确保您的系统中已安装以下软件:
- Python 3.x(建议使用最新版)
- pip(Python的包管理器)
- pipx(用于安装全球Python包的工具)
项目安装步骤
安装vsketch
- 打开终端或命令提示符。
- 输入以下命令来全局安装vsketch:
pipx install vsketch
运行示例
- 下载vsketch的示例文件(请自行搜索并下载,这里不提供链接)。
- 解压下载的文件。
- 运行以下命令来执行一个示例草图:
vsk run path/to/vsketch-master/examples/schotter
创建新项目
- 在终端中,导航到您希望创建项目的目录。
- 使用以下命令创建一个新项目:
vsk init my_project
这将创建一个包含所需所有文件的新项目结构。
运行新项目
- 在终端中,导航到新创建的项目目录。
- 运行以下命令来执行草图:
vsk run my_project
按照以上步骤,您应该能够成功安装和配置vsketch项目,并开始您的生成艺术创作。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考